Using Segment Displays

  1. Step 1: Select component mode.
  2. Step 2: Click on Pick devices ‘P’ .
  3. Step 3: Type Segment in the Keyword textbox and select the 1 Digit seven segment display with common anode and common cathode.
  4. Step 4: Select 8-element DIP Switches with common terminal.

What is common cathode 7 segment?

Common Cathode 7-segment Display In this type of display, all the cathode connections of the LED segments are connected together to logic 0 or ground. The separate segments are lightened by applying the logic 1 or HIGH signal through a current limiting resistor to forward bias the individual anode terminals a to g.

How do you test for the common cathode 7 segment?

Put your multimeter’s black lead on pin 3 or 8. Both are common pin as they are internally connected. Now put your meter’s red lead on any other pin such as 1 or 5. If any of the display’s segments glow then the display is common cathode.

What is a common cathode display?

In the common cathode display, all the cathode connections of the LED segments are connected together to ‘logic 0’ / GND. The individual segments are then illuminated by applying HIGH / ‘logic 1’ signal to the individual Anode terminals (a-g).

How does a common anode 7-segment display work?

The Common Anode (CA) – In the common anode display, all the anode connections of the LED segments are joined together to logic “1”. The individual segments are illuminated by applying a ground, logic “0” or “LOW” signal via a suitable current limiting resistor to the Cathode of the particular segment (a-g).
